Solution for 2X^2-11X-6=0 equation:


Simplifying
2X2 + -11X + -6 = 0

Reorder the terms:
-6 + -11X + 2X2 = 0

Solving
-6 + -11X + 2X2 = 0

Solving for variable 'X'.

Factor a trinomial.
(-1 + -2X)(6 + -1X) = 0

Subproblem 1

Set the factor '(-1 + -2X)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ying -1 + -2X = 0 Solving -1 + -2X = 0 Move all terms containing X to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'1' to each side of the equation. -1 + 1 + -2X = 0 + 1 Combine like terms: -1 + 1 = 0 0 + -2X = 0 + 1 -2X = 0 + 1 Combine like terms: 0 + 1 = 1 -2X = 1 Divide each side by '-2'. X = -0.5 Simplifying X = -0.5

Subproblem 2

Set the factor '(6 + -1X)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 6 + -1X = 0 Solving 6 + -1X = 0 Move all terms containing X to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-6' to each side of the equation. 6 + -6 + -1X = 0 + -6 Combine like terms: 6 + -6 = 0 0 + -1X = 0 + -6 -1X = 0 + -6 Combine like terms: 0 + -6 = -6 -1X = -6 Divide each side by '-1'. X = 6 Simplifying X = 6

Solution

X = {-0.5, 6}
